Onboarding note for the Ledgerpane admin table: bulk edits are applied through the batcher service, not directly against the database. Select rows, choose an action, and the batcher stages changes in a pending set you can review before commit. Edits over 500 rows require a second approver — this is enforced server-side, so don't try to chunk around it. To run the batcher locally you need the staging write credential, which goes in your .env as the next line.

secret setting of bahip-kagag: RELAY_SECRET3=c83

Handover — CSV Import Wizard (Pellwick)

Taking off for the week; here's where things stand. The import wizard in Pellwick is stable, but large files from the Norvane account occasionally trip the row-validation timeout. I bumped the worker count Tuesday and it's held since. If imports stall, check the dead-letter queue first — reprocessing is safe and idempotent. Don't touch the delimiter-sniffing logic; it's fragile and Marit owns it. The wizard reads all tuning parameters from the service config at startup, reproduced below.

config for kafof-bawef:
holath:
  log_level: debug
  metrics_host: metrics.holath.qorvelsys.internal
  pin: 2191
  pool_size: 32

Q2 requires an inventory write-down on the Brindel valve line following the failed Torvex retrofit program. Obsolete stock valued at roughly eight percent of total inventory will be written off this quarter. Auditors have reviewed methodology; no restatement of prior periods needed. Production shifts to the Calder line immediately, with surplus components scrapped or sold at salvage. Margin impact is one-time. Strategic rationale is detailed in the confidential note on business plans below.

board note of baguf-fafog: Kasixox Foods plans to lower the Drueth list price by 48 percent in March.